WebKit Bugzilla
New
Browse
Search+
Log In
×
Sign in with GitHub
or
Remember my login
Create Account
·
Forgot Password
Forgotten password account recovery
RESOLVED FIXED
267192
SVG element is not displayed if it is inside a <switch> element and it has an SVGFilter resource
https://bugs.webkit.org/show_bug.cgi?id=267192
Summary
SVG element is not displayed if it is inside a <switch> element and it has an...
Ahmad Saleem
Reported
2024-01-06 18:25:58 PST
Hi Team, I know I know, it is vague title for bug but I am still thought to at least raise it so we can track for future. SVG Image Link -
https://ikgp.de/wp-content/uploads/2023/12/Anmeldung_5_oS-1.svg
It does not load in Safari 17.2.1 & Safari Technology Preview 185 but load fine in Chrome Canary 122 and Firefox Nightly 123. Twitter (X) link (from where this example comes) -
https://x.com/AaronDewes/status/1743737956815237264
Just wanted to raise it now before it goes away in timeline etc. Thanks!
Attachments
reduced test case
(326 bytes, image/svg+xml)
2024-01-09 12:12 PST
,
Said Abou-Hallawa
no flags
Details
View All
Add attachment
proposed patch, testcase, etc.
Ahmad Saleem
Comment 1
2024-01-06 18:48:03 PST
GOOD NEWS! Just to flag - Layer Based SVG Engine display the image on WebKit ToT (local build -
272741@main
). Although it does not have 'shadow' effect on top of image like Chrome Canary 122. Still something to fix in LBSE, so adding `LayerBasedSVGEngine` as well.
Simon Fraser (smfr)
Comment 2
2024-01-08 12:55:50 PST
Related to the <filter>
Radar WebKit Bug Importer
Comment 3
2024-01-09 12:02:16 PST
<
rdar://problem/120732837
>
Said Abou-Hallawa
Comment 4
2024-01-09 12:11:16 PST
Pull request:
https://github.com/WebKit/WebKit/pull/22549
Said Abou-Hallawa
Comment 5
2024-01-09 12:12:33 PST
Created
attachment 469347
[details]
reduced test case
EWS
Comment 6
2024-01-09 17:20:39 PST
Committed
272831@main
(df6e4e277baa): <
https://commits.webkit.org/272831@main
> Reviewed commits have been landed. Closing PR #22549 and removing active labels.
Note
You need to
log in
before you can comment on or make changes to this bug.
Top of Page
Format For Printing
XML
Clone This Bug